What is a heb?

An H-E-B job refers to employment at H-E-B, a well-known supermarket chain based in Texas. H-E-B offers various positions in retail, warehouse, corporate, and management roles. Employees enjoy competitive pay, benefits, and opportunities for career growth. The company is recognized for its strong commitment to customer service and community involvement.

What are heb employees responsible for?

HEB employees work in various roles within HEB grocery stores, ranging from cashiers and stockers to department managers and bakers. Their responsibilities typically include assisting customers, stocking shelves, maintaining store cleanliness, operating registers, and ensuring that the store runs smoothly. Employees are also expected to provide excellent customer service and contribute to a positive shopping experience.
